Habit Health is a nationwide healthcare provider, specialising in the rehabilitation space. We enable people to live their best lives and empower our teams to realise their full potential.

Our Victoria Street Clinic in Hamilton is seeking a driven and skilled Community Physiotherapist to join our multidisciplinary team. This role provides the opportunity to work predominantly within our ACC Concussion and Pain contracts, supporting clients to achieve meaningful outcomes and improve their quality of life.

This is a permanent full-time position offering a varied caseload across the community and clinic settings. You will work alongside an experienced interdisciplinary team, delivering client-centred rehabilitation programmes and contributing to positive health outcomes for people experiencing the effects of concussion and persistent pain.

Main Responsibilities

- Deliver assessment and rehabilitation services for clients under ACC Concussion and Pain contracts
- Develop and implement individualised rehabilitation programmes in both community and clinic settings
- Work collaboratively with psychologists, occupational therapists, exercise physiologists, rehabilitation consultants, and other allied health professionals
- Complete comprehensive clinical assessments, goal setting, and progress reviews
- Prepare high-quality reports outlining client abilities, goals, recommendations, and treatment outcomes
- Utilise diary management and clinical software systems effectively
- Support clients to achieve independence, return to meaningful activities, and improve functional outcomes

The Ideal Candidate

- NZ Physiotherapy registration with a current APC
- Experience working within ACC-funded rehabilitation services is preferred
- Experience or a strong interest in concussion rehabilitation and pain management
- Understanding of a biopsychosocial approach to rehabilitation
- Full New Zealand Driver Licence, as community-based work is required
- Excellent communication and relationship-building skills
- Ability to work autonomously while contributing effectively within a multidisciplinary team
